Flexible Liner Upgrade Benefits

Vinyl liner replacement is one of the top cost-effective solutions for renovating or building an in-ground pool on a budget. These systems offer soft surfaces, straightforward repairs, and a wide range of patterns. While not as long-lasting as fibreglass or concrete, modern vinyl liners last 6–10 years with proper care and UV protection.

Eco-Friendly Saltwater Pool Systems

A saltwater pool system uses a low-irritant saline solution to generate chlorine, offering a more comfortable swim than traditional chlorinated pools. Swimmers enjoy less drying water, fewer chemical odors, and easier maintenance. Paired with smart pool controls, these systems are ideal for eco-conscious families in northwest Calgary.

Winter Ground Penetration Impact

In the Rocky Mountain climate, frost can penetrate deep underground, making frost protection a non-negotiable part of any in-ground pool installation. Concrete pool contractors use properly buried plumbing and structural designs that resist freeze-thaw damage. Pool excavation service teams also position footings and utilities below the frost line to prevent cracking, shifting, and emergency pool repair needs.

Neglecting frost depth can lead to severe structural failures over time.

On-Site Infrastructure Cable Mapping

Before any dig begins, a professional pool excavation service must locate and mark all underground utility lines — including gas, water, electrical, and telecom. Hitting a line causes danger, so Alberta law requires a pre-excavation check. Certified pool builders coordinate with local authorities to ensure your in-ground swimming pool is positioned safely away from these critical systems.

Detailed mapping prevents accidents and keeps your project on schedule and within Calgary building permits guidelines.

Earth Removal and Base Preparation

The pool excavation service shapes your backyard according to the approved design, removing soil with precision to match the pool’s dimensions and depth. Once dug, the hole is lined with a compacted gravel base and forms for the concrete shell — a step critical for long-term stability in frost-prone areas. This phase also includes rough-in plumbing placement before any concrete is poured.

Experienced concrete pool contractors ensure every inch aligns with the engineered plans for a flawless build.

Winterization for the Calgary Climate

Effective cold-climate prep is vital for any fibreglass installation in Calgary NW, where frost can damage pipes, pumps, and frost-vulnerable components.

  • Adjust water levels below skimmer
  • Blow out all conduits with compressed air
  • Install a durable pool cover with cable and winch
